International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co grading scale

Every grade International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co awards, the points it carries, and whether it counts toward the GPA or earns credit. This is the table the calculator above runs on.

International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co grade points, GPA inclusion and credit rules
GradeMeaningPointsGPA countedCredit earned
A+Excellent4.3YesYes
AExcellent4.0YesYes
A-Excellent3.7YesYes
B+Good3.3YesYes
BGood3.0YesYes
B-Good2.7YesYes
C+Average2.3YesYes
CAverage2.0YesYes
C-Average1.7YesYes
DPassing1.0YesYes
FFailure0.0YesNo
IIncomplete0.0YesNo
WWithdrawExcludedNoNo
XPendingExcludedNoNo

How the International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co GPA formula works

International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co converts every graded course into quality points by multiplying the grade's point value by the course's credit hours. Your semester GPA is the total quality points divided by the total credit hours that count toward the GPA, and the result is rounded to the nearest 2 decimal places. Points run from 0.0 up to 4.3, so a higher average is a better result. The scale uses plus and minus grades, so there are 12 distinct point values rather than a handful of whole steps: A+ is worth 4.3 and A is worth 4.0.

What gets left out of the average

W and X carry no point value at International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co, so a course marked with one of them drops out of the division entirely โ€” it changes neither the top nor the bottom of the fraction. F and I work the other way: they earn no credit but are still counted in the average at 0.0 points, so a failed course pulls the average down while adding nothing to your progress.

How this semester rolls into your CGPA

IIHEM defines GPA as the average of grade points in the student's academic transcript. Enter the same credit value for each course to compute that equal-weight average. In practice that means your existing CGPA is turned back into quality points by multiplying it by your completed credits, this semester's quality points are added on, and the total is divided by your new credit total. Both the semester and the cumulative figures are rounded to the nearest 2 decimal places. The better of the two attempts is the one that counts; the weaker grade is dropped from the cumulative average.

Worked examples

Each example below is run through the same engine the calculator uses, so the numbers show International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co's own rounding.

A typical graded semester

A student sitting at 3.10 after 60 completed credits takes 3 courses worth 3 credits each.

  • Core course3 credits ร— A+ (4.3 points)
  • Elective3 credits ร— A- (3.7 points)
  • Lab or seminar3 credits ร— B (3.0 points)

Semester GPA 3.67 ยท Updated CGPA 3.17

The semester total is 33 quality points over 9 counted credits. Because the cumulative average now spans 69 credits, one semester moves it only a little โ€” this is why a CGPA gets harder to shift the further into a degree you are.

Adding a course graded W

The same student adds a fourth 3-credit course graded W (Withdraw).

  • Core course3 credits ร— A+ (4.3 points)
  • Elective3 credits ร— A- (3.7 points)
  • Lab or seminar3 credits ร— B (3.0 points)
  • Withdraw course3 credits ร— W (no grade points)

Semester GPA 3.67 ยท Updated CGPA 3.17

The semester GPA is unchanged at 3.67. W carries no grade points at International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co, so the course is removed from both sides of the division. Students often expect a fourth course to move the average and are surprised when it does not.

What one F costs

The same semester again, but the last course comes back as F (Failure) instead.

  • Core course3 credits ร— A+ (4.3 points)
  • Elective3 credits ร— A- (3.7 points)
  • Failed course3 credits ร— F (0.0 points)

Semester GPA 2.67 ยท Updated CGPA 3.04

The semester GPA slips from 3.67 to 2.67, and the cumulative average slips from 3.17 to 3.04. F is worth 0.0 points and earns no credit, so it weighs the average down while adding nothing to your degree progress.

Common mistakes when calculating your International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co GPA

These are the places where the International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co rules differ from what most students assume, and where a hand calculation usually goes wrong.

  1. Dropping a failed course from the calculation

    F and I earn no credit toward the degree, but they are still counted in the GPA at 0.0 points. Leaving a failure out flatters the result.

  2. Guessing the plus/minus values

    At International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co, A+ is worth 4.3 and A is worth 4.0. Those steps differ between universities, so a value copied from another school's chart will quietly skew the whole average.

  3. Averaging the grades instead of weighting them

    A course worth twice the credits moves your GPA twice as much. Adding up your grade points and dividing by the number of courses ignores that weighting and is almost always wrong.

  4. Expecting a 0-credit course to move the number

    International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co allows them, but with no credit hours they contribute nothing to either side of the division.

  5. Handling a retake by guesswork

    The better of the two attempts is the one that counts; the weaker grade is dropped from the cumulative average. Check the current catalog before assuming an old grade has left your record.

Notes on this university's data

Judgement calls and caveats recorded when this grading configuration was built from the official sources. They are published so you can see exactly what the calculator assumes.

  • International Institute for Higher Education in Morocco has its own official grading system and is not treated as a generic Morocco formula.
  • The official IIHEM page states grades are assigned on a 4.3 to 0 scale and defines GPA as the average of grade points in the academic transcript.
  • Because the official GPA definition is an equal average of transcript grade points, users should enter the same credit value for each course unless a program-specific official credit weighting is being applied.
  • I is encoded as a 0-point GPA grade because the official table lists Incomplete with grade points of 0; W and X are excluded because the official table lists no grade points for them.
  • The retake rule is encoded as highest-grade replacement because the official page states only the highest grade received for a retaken course is used in computing GPA.
